How Does My Chainsaw Chain Keep Loosening?

Backyard Mike is reader-supported. When you buy through links on my site, I may earn an affiliate commission. Disclaimer

Your chainsaw chain keeps loosening due to improper tension adjustment, causing frequent loosening, especially with new chains needing frequent adjustments after stretching. Friction-induced expansion and contraction during operation also lead to slack. Additionally, uneven wear from improper sharpening or guide bar misalignment can contribute. Regularly inspect your chain tension, adjust as needed, and guarantee proper tensioning before use for better performance. By doing so, you'll find effective solutions and enhance chainsaw safety and efficiency over time.

The Role of Friction and Heat in Chain Loosening

When you use a chainsaw, friction generates heat, causing both the chain and guide bar to expand. As the metal cools down after use, this expansion leads to chain slack, making it seem loose. Over time, wear and tear from regular use can also contribute to frequent chain loosening. To guarantee your chainsaw operates safely and effectively, regularly check and adjust the chain tension, especially during and after prolonged use. Stretching During the Break-In Period

During the break-in period, chainsaw chains are particularly prone to stretching, which requires extra vigilance in maintaining the correct tension. As a new chain expands due to heat and contracts when cooling, you'll notice frequent changes in tension. Initial cuts should be made with awareness of chain tension, and checking chain tension after starting the saw is crucial. It's crucial to practice proper break-in techniques, like regularly checking and adjusting the tension. This guarantees safety and extends your chain's lifespan.

To maintain ideal tension, remember to allow for slight slack—about 1/8" to 1/4"—when pulling the chain. Use a screwdriver or wrench to adjust the tension screw in small increments, lifting the bar tip for even tension.

Retighten bar nuts after adjustments. With consistent tension maintenance, you'll adapt quickly and reduce the need for frequent adjustments over time.

How to Check Your Chainsaw's Chain Tension

Checking your chainsaw's chain tension is essential for safe and efficient operation.

Begin by performing the pull test: gently pull the chain away from the guide bar to verify drive links remain engaged.

Next, try the snap test by pulling the chain back and letting it go; it should snap back into place.

For more precise chain maintenance, use a tension gauge to measure and adjust the tension according to the manufacturer's guidelines.

Conduct a visual inspection for any sagging or uneven tension around the guide bar.

Remember, proper tension adjustment means the chain should have minimal slack, move smoothly, and not sag excessively.

Regular tension checks and adjustments are essential to ensure the chainsaw operates safely and efficiently.

Confirming these checks will help maintain your chainsaw's performance and prolong its lifespan.

Tips for Preventing Frequent Chain Loosening

Making certain your chainsaw chain stays secure is essential for both safety and efficiency. By following a few straightforward tips, you can prevent frequent chain loosening and enhance your tool's reliability.

Ensuring your chainsaw chain is secure boosts safety and enhances tool reliability.

  1. Regular Chain Maintenance: Routinely inspect your chainsaw's components, focusing on the chain and guide bar. Check for wear, and make sure that the chain is correctly fitted to the bar.
  2. Tension Adjustments: Before each use, adjust the chain tension. Confirm it's neither too tight nor too loose, accounting for heat expansion post-operation. Experienced users emphasize the importance of closely monitoring chain tension to prevent issues during use.
  3. Quality Components: Invest in high-quality chains, bars, and sprockets. Durable materials reduce the risk of stretching and wear, maintaining proper tension longer.
